Hi,
I noticed that vm is now in the trunk, so I decided to run some benchmarks
to test it for robustness. While doing this, I found a problem that seems
to be related to continuations, although guile crashes in gc. I have
attached a minimal and self-contained testcase here. Note that iterating
50 or so times is required to trigger the segfault so that is not "extra
code".
I have also found problems with other tests from the same benchmark, and
at least one of them is using call-with-current-continuation also (others
I have not looked at yet). I will report them as well, but right now I
don't have reduced testcases for them and they are likely duplicates.
